episode 17
aired 3/03/04
synopsis: Episode
starts off with Jessica talking about starting junior high in 7th grade,
where the teacher asked the class to name the 7 continents. Jessica raises
her hands and goes, "AEIOU"....doh!
The stupidity lessons
continue during a discussion of Jessica's commitment to some post party
performance (super bowl). Jessica says she wants to be at the Golden Globes.
The debate is on what "post party" means, before or after. And
somehow or another it leads to a debate on postage stamps and the post
office.
In another scene,
back at the hotel room, Jessica is just leaving with Nick and bumps her
back into the door knob. She exclaims, "I think i just broke my kidney".
Nick and Jessica are next scene at dinner with Drew and Lea. At this dinner,
Nick brings up that an In Touch reporter sprung a question on Nick on
whether Jessica is pregnant. Jessica remarks, she doesn't think she is
quite ready to have a baby quite yet. She feels she needs a dog first
(stay tuned for the next episode when Nick wants a Siberian Husky...70lb
dog).
The rest of the episode
is Jessica centered. It starts with a photo shoot involving poses that
have her licking frosting from a cupcake. Not just one, but like a billion.
And Jessica actually eats the frosting as she does the photo shoot. Little
wonder she goes on and gets sick. At one point she is in the bathroom,
squatting above the floor. She gets a plate of crackers, which she proceeds
to put on the floor, and starts snacking from the floor. (yuck?!!). Then
cutting the photo shoot short, she and Nick go back to their hotel room.
She sits in the corner of the elevator, and then proceeds to crawl to
her door.
The next day, Nick
is seen going to ESPNzone with Drew. Jessica goes to Fred's for pizza
with her mom. Apparently Jessica needs to call Nick to find out why bratswurst
is white in color? She thinks it's a German pig and that its white which
is why the meat is white in color. Message of advice? Don't call Nick
when he's in a sports bar with buddies.
